Abstract: Certain cooking items still fall under the same classifications. The problem is that the general public has limited access to updated records. The objective of this study is to ascertain the difficulty of automatically identifying a meal in a photograph for cooking and then automatically generating the appropriate recipe. Due to significant overlaps in food dishes and the possibility that meals from various categories may simply resemble one another visually, the chosen job is more challenging than previous supervised classification difficulties (also known as high intra-class similarity). Convolutional Neural Networks (or CNNs for short) are used to distinguish objects or food courts while concurrently looking for adjacent neighbours (Next-Neighbour Classification).
